Package description:
  vim 
  VIM (VIsual editor iMproved) is an updated and improved version of the
  vi editor. Vi was the first real screen-based editor for UNIX, and is
  still very popular. VIM improves on vi by adding new features: multiple
  windows, multi-level undo, block highlighting and more.

Problem description:
  vim < TSL 3.0 >
  - New upstream.
  - Spell checking support for about 50 languages.
  - Intelligent completion for C, HTML, Ruby, Python, PHP, etc.
  - Tab pages, each containing multiple windows.
  - Vim script supports Lists and Dictionaries (similar to Python).
  - Improved Unicode support.
  - Browsing remote directories, zip and tar archives.

About Trustix Secure Linux:
  Trustix Secure Linux is a small Linux distribution for servers. With focus
  on security and stability, the system is painlessly kept safe and up to
  date from day one using swup, the automated software updater.
